About Thurston

Thurston, Ann Arbor’s quiet, leafy residential pocket.

Thurston in Ann Arbor is a quiet northside neighborhood with easy access to Plymouth Road, North Campus, and the Thurston Nature Area. Stay here for leafy residential streets, quick AATA bus connections, and a practical base near local cafes, grocery stops, and downtown Ann Arbor.

Thurston local tips

Know the rhythm before you go.

Thurston is easiest with a little planning: which neighborhood to pick, when it’s quiet, and how to get around.

Plan for car access

Thurston is mostly a residential Ann Arbor neighborhood, so staying here usually works best with a car or ride share. Parking can be easier than downtown, but check your host’s setup before you arrive.

Expect quieter nights

Thurston is calmer than the city’s nightlife districts, which makes it a good fit if you want rest after dinner or campus visits. Light traffic and fewer late crowds help, though street noise can still vary.

Choose close to your plans

If you’re visiting the University of Michigan, nearby parks, or Northside errands, staying in Thurston saves time. For downtown dining or game days, being close matters more so you can avoid parking pressure and transit delays.

How walkable is Thurston in Ann Arbor for a booking?

Thurston is a quiet residential neighborhood, so you can walk to some local parks and nearby daily essentials, but it is not a dense, all-in-one district. If you want to rely on walking for dining and nightlife, check your exact address on the listing and plan for short rides to busier areas.

02 / 05
Do you need a car when staying in Thurston, Ann Arbor?

A car is helpful in Thurston, especially if you want flexible access to downtown Ann Arbor, campus areas, and shopping corridors. Public transit and rideshares may work for some trips, but parking, distance, and your itinerary will shape what is most convenient. Confirm parking details on the property listing.

03 / 05
What is the atmosphere like in Thurston, Ann Arbor before you book?

Thurston feels calm, residential, and neighborly, with a slower pace than Ann Arbor's busier commercial areas. It is a good fit if you prefer a quieter stay with tree-lined streets and local parks nearby. Exact noise levels and surroundings can vary by block, so review the listing location carefully.
